What is Therapeutic Massage

Massage therapy is a science and an art, with touch as the key ingredient. Our practitioners have learned a variety of specific techniques for massage. They use their sense of touch to determine the right amount of pressure to apply to each person and to locate areas of tension and other soft-tissue problems. Touch also conveys a sense of caring, an important component in the healing relationship.

The core goal of massage therapy is to help the body heal itself and to increase health and well-being.

When muscles are overworked, waste products such as lactic acid can accumulate in the muscle, causing soreness, stiffness, and even muscle spasm. Massage improves circulation, which increases blood flow, bringing fresh oxygen to body tissues. This can assist the elimination of waste products, speed healing after injury, and enhance recovery from disease.

Therapeutic massage can be used to promote general well-being while boosting the circulatory and immune systems to benefit blood pressure, circulation, muscle tone, digestion, and skin tone. Massage has been incorporated into many health systems, and different techniques have been developed and integrated into various complementary therapies.

Our Massage Techniques

SWEDISH MASSAGE is used by our therapists to administer soothing, tapping and kneading strokes to work the entire body, relieving muscle tension and loosening sore joints. Our therapists are highly skilled in using five basic Swedish massage strokes very effectively. They are effleurage (stroking); petrissage (muscles are lightly grabbed and lifted); friction (thumbs and fingertips work in deep circles into the thickest part of muscles; tapotement (chopping, beating, and tapping strokes); and vibration (fingers are pressed or flattened firmly on a muscle, then the area is shaken rapidly for a few seconds).

DEEP TISSUE MASSAGE targets chronic tension in muscles that lie far below the surface of your body. You have five layers of muscle in your back, for instance, and while Swedish massage may help the first couple of layers, it won’t do much directly for the muscle underneath. Deep muscle techniques usually involve slow strokes and direct pressure or friction movements that go across the grain of the muscles. Our massage therapists will use their fingers, thumbs or occasionally even elbows to apply the needed pressure.

PRENATAL MASSAGE shares many of the goals of regular massage — to relax tense muscles, ease sore spots, improve circulation and mobility, and just make you feel good. But it’s also tailored specifically to the needs of pregnant women and their changing bodies, and our therapists know how to adjust their techniques accordingly. Massages can be done side-lying or face-down with the use of special pregnancy pillows. Your comfort is our priority.

HOT STONE MASSAGE is extremely relaxing and therapeutic as the stones are used in two ways during the massage. One is to impart heat onto the body by laying stones under the client with a towel between the client and stone and/or on top of the client, again upon a towel. The stones are typically placed along the spine, on the legs, on the hands and on the arms. The stones become concentrated centers of heat while the therapist is simultaneously massaging the client with oiled, heated stones held in the palm of the hand. The therapist will use firm strokes along the muscles of the legs, arms, and torso areas. Our therapists don’t simply “glide” the heated stones lightly upon the surface of the skin, but rather the stones are used as tools to deliver effective tissue and muscle massage at a pressure level comfortable to the client. The client can request light, medium or deep pressure, which is the beauty of the hot stone massage technique. It can be customized in an instant to the request of the client. The heat from the stones relaxes muscles, increase the blood flow to the area being worked on which further accelerates the healing process. This increase in circulation and the relaxation of the muscles also aids in mental relaxation.
